Deadcam is a single player survival action adventure game with a horror theme. It was developed by Alien Big Cat and was released on November 5, 2025. It received positive reviews from players.

Deadcam is a first-person psychological horror game where you must survive a night trapped in an abandoned rural house during a paranormal hunting show gone wrong. With your crew member Margo behaving disturbingly and her live headcam feed revealing unsettling truths, you must run, hide, and escape while uncovering dark secrets—remember, the raccoon knows everything.

  • Deadcam offers a unique and terrifying concept with its headcam mechanic, creating a constant sense of dread and paranoia.
  • The game successfully establishes an oppressive atmosphere through its sound design and visual presentation, enhancing the psychological horror experience.
  • Players appreciate the game's originality and immersive gameplay, particularly its focus on stealth and decision-making rather than traditional combat.
  • Many players feel the game lacks polish and content, with some stating it feels no different from the demo and is too short for the price.
  • The randomized item locations can be frustrating, leading to a gameplay experience that feels more based on luck than skill.
  • Critics have pointed out issues with NPC animations and movement, making the gameplay feel less engaging and more robotic.
  • gameplay
    11 mentions Positive Neutral Negative

    The gameplay in "Deadcam" is characterized by a unique headcam mechanic that enhances stealth and spatial awareness, creating a tense atmosphere as players navigate a controlled environment. While some players appreciate the immersive dread and strategic pacing, others find the gameplay repetitive and feel that mundane actions, like searching for items, detract from the overall experience. Overall, the combination of innovative mechanics and a compelling narrative contributes to a personal and unsettling gameplay experience.

    • “Gameplay in Deadcam is built around stealth, spatial awareness, and restraint.”
    • “This mechanic adds a layer of dread beyond standard enemy tracking, as it feels less like monitoring a monster and more like watching a corrupted human presence that is aware of you in return.”
    • “By combining a compelling found-footage concept with a unique headcam mechanic and a tightly controlled environment, Alien Big Cat delivers an experience that feels personal, unsettling, and persistently tense.”
    • “Margo and the gameplay become boring pretty fast.”
    • “Opening drawers and cupboards isn’t gameplay!!”
    • “Some sections deliberately stretch tension by forcing players to wait, listen, or carefully plan their movements, which may feel demanding to those seeking faster gameplay but ultimately strengthens immersion.”
